The Change Management Specialist plays a key role in ensuring that projects (change initiatives) meet objectives. The primary responsibility is to support and implement change management strategies and operational plans that facilitate and maximize maximize employee adoption and usage and minimize resistance.

A change management specialist focuses on supporting the Change Team in maximizing and optimizing resources and plans utilizing a variety of disciplines.

Change specialists help move organizational change forward by:
Building an awareness of and a desire for committing to change
Supporting employees as they build the proper skills and tools they need to enact change
Establishing a bond of trust and strong two-way communication mechanisms
Collaborating and assist in developing change strategy

Essential Duties: 

Specific job responsibilities for change management specialists can include but are not limited to: 

Partnering on and facilitating needs assessments 

Drafting and implementing communications  

Coordinating strategy and project plans 

Processing feedback and analyzing data around effectiveness of change activities and adoption 

Assist in the creation of training programs, including requirements, design, and delivery 

Supporting resistance management strategies  

Coordinate efforts with other specialized groups with HR and IT as needed to execute change strategies
